Gill broadside from Rafa
Liverpool boss Rafael Benitez has taken a swipe at Manchester United chief executive David Gill.
He has followed up his blast at manager Sir Alex Ferguson by questioning Gill also holding a senior role at the FA.
Benitez said: "Is there a conflict of interest? It is a fact that one person has a lot of power and control, and is on a lot of committees in the FA. To me, that is very strange."
Riera ready for big push
Liverpool midfielder Albert Riera insists the Reds will not be found wanting when the title race hots up.
Reigning champions Manchester United narrowed the gap on the Barclays Premier League leaders to five points by defeating Chelsea at Old Trafford.
The Spaniard told the Liverpool Echo: "I can tell our fans that we will compete for every single point in every game that we play."
